Imaginarium 2.0 picks 10 bright artists to showcase their art

Held at Emami Art Gallery, the annual open call award saw Ali Akbar PN, Sudhir Ambasana and Puja Mondal at the top three

The second edition of Imaginarium, the annual open call award and exhibition for young artists, saw 10 extremely talented artists showcase their artwork at Emami Art. Selected from 200 budding artists from across India, the top three artists from the list include Ali Akbar PN, Sudhir Ambasana and Puja Mondal. Talking about the project which is close to her heart, Richa Agarwal, CEO of Emami Art, says, “Imaginarium is a show which is close to our hearts at Emami. When we started the gallery, we always spoke about young artists who can be shown alongside with senior artists; in the same kind of treatment. It was a task for the jury to choose 10 names from 200 talented artists.”
